The freight market in Southern California has emerged as the cornerstone of the U.S. economy. Yet, in recent months, container ships have faced record volume and record delays at the San Pedro Bay ports. So have truck drivers. 

Just how much is the port congestion affecting truckload freight in Southern California?

We dug into our proprietary freight data, as well as publicly available transportation and economic data and research, to find out.
